Introduction
The year is 2428. For the last 300 years, humanity has crawled from its bunkers and began to rebuild itself after a global nuclear apocalypse. After the initial century in hiding and the long struggle to re-conquer the surface in the face of radiation, mutants and tribals, has ended, and in parts of the world were man still lives, and the land is still liveable, governing bodies have grown from smaller organisations into true rulers of their domains. Now, the governments of this new world will explore, expand and conquer the lands around them, to expand resources and power.
So essentially, you will have to form a post-nuclear government of your own design. The world is filled with advanced, retro-futuristic technology and mutated men and creatures. Whilst your government can be a continuation of a pre-war organisation, you will not be allowed to play as a surviving pre-war government. The geographical setting will be in the continental United States, Canada, Alaska and Mexico. Each government should only have an area equivalent to 1-3 states. Bigger governments will generally be harder to run as the government will be more stretched in its operations against internal threats.
